Analysis

The most recent figure for gross graduation ratio from first degree programmes (isced 6 and 7) in WB: Latin America & Caribbean is 24.8%, measured in 2022. That is the highest value across all 23 years on record.

That represents a change of up 5.5% on the previous year and up 24.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, gross graduation ratio from first degree programmes (isced 6 and 7) in WB: Latin America & Caribbean peaked at 24.8% in 2022 and was at its lowest, 12.5%, in 2002.

WB: Latin America & Caribbean ranks 96th of 198 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 23 years of available data.

Gross graduation ratio from first degree programmes (ISCED 6 and 7) in WB: Latin America & Caribbean, year by year

Annual values for Gross graduation ratio from first degree programmes (ISCED 6 and 7) in tertiary education, both sexes (%) in WB: Latin America & Caribbean, 2000 to 2022.
Year % Change
2000 16.4%
2001 16.6% +1.2%
2002 12.5% -24.5%
2003 13.3% +6.0%
2004 14.5% +9.0%
2005 15.6% +7.5%
2006 18.0% +15.6%
2007 16.4% -8.6%
2008 17.4% +5.8%
2009 18.8% +8.5%
2010 18.8% +0.0%
2011 19.6% +4.1%
2012 19.9% +1.4%
2013 20.3% +2.1%
2014 20.2% -0.7%
2015 20.6% +1.9%
2016 21.5% +4.6%
2017 21.8% +1.3%
2018 22.2% +1.7%
2019 23.1% +4.1%
2020 23.1% +0.1%
2021 23.5% +1.7%
2022 24.8% +5.5%
